The conventional unit of measuring the speed of a DC motor is in RPM. RPM speed varies for different electronic devices, depending on the nature of its task. A device needing fast motion will require a motor of a relatively high RPM range, whereas precision work requires a much lower RPM. Moreover, measuring the RPM of a motor using tachometer is useful, of which there are both contact and non-contact types. Lastly, RPM can be converted to a different speed unit, called radians per second.
